Earlier Wednesday morning, SCE officials began to receive several reports of a power outage throughout Canyon Country, in areas mostly north of Soledad Canyon Road from Whites Canyon Road to Deep Creek Drive.
After investigating these reports, officials estimated that approximately 10,261 SCE customers had been impacted by the Canyon Country power outages.
Reggie Kumar, a spokesperson for SCE, later confirmed that those outages were actually related to PSPS, but were miscatagorized in their Outage Center system.
When a PSPS is instated in any of the monitored areas, SCE officials say that Community Crew Vehicles and Community Resource Centers will be made available to support customers in impacted areas.
